In the vast world of biblical exegesis and theological scholarship, Frank Nelson Palmer's A Bird's-Eye View of the Bible Second Edition stands out as a comprehensive and accessible guide that sparks curiosity and engages readers with its refreshing perspective.

Palmer, an esteemed biblical scholar, delves into the depths of the Bible, aiming to provide an overview of its grand narrative, emphasizing key themes and historical contexts throughout. While countless books exist on biblical interpretation, A Bird's-Eye View distinguishes itself through its unique structure and writing style, which make it a valuable resource for both beginners and seasoned enthusiasts.

One of the most commendable aspects of Palmer's book is its organized approach. The author masterfully divides the Bible into various sections, each receiving thorough exploration. By examining the texts book by book, Palmer ensures that readers can easily navigate the complex web of stories, prophecies, and messages contained within the Scripture.
